About Amaroo 2914

The size of Amaroo is approximately 2.6 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 17.3% of total area. The population of Amaroo in 2016 was 5710 people. By 2021 the population was 6129 showing a population growth of 7.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Amaroo is 40-49 years. Households in Amaroo are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Amaroo work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.90% of the homes in Amaroo were owner-occupied compared with 73.00% in 2016.

Amaroo has 2,210 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Amaroo have seen a 28.79%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 18.82% increase. As at 31 March 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Amaroo is $1,083,978 while the median value for Units is $696,170.
  • Houses have a median rent of $730 while Units have a median rent of $555.
